Highlanders Lose to Delaware State

Oct. 21, 2006

Box Score

DOVER, DE - Host Delaware State took a 3-1 win from New Jersey Institute of Technology in the Highlanders' second match at the Delaware State University Invitational in women's volleyball Saturday afternoon.

All four games were close, as Delaware State prevailed, 30-27, 28-30, 30-28 and 31-29. The loss evened NJIT's record in the tournament at 1-1, after the Highlanders opened with a 3-0 win over Winston-Salem State on Friday. Delaware State, which also beat Winston-Salem, went to 2-0 with the win over NJIT.

Freshman Kristy Haeckel led the Highlanders with 19 kills, while Kasha Hornstein added 10 kills. Danielle Thompson, the sophomore setter, was credited with 46 assists.

Hornstein, also a freshman, registered a team-best 14 digs and a third freshman, Sabrina Baby had 10 digs. Baby had a team-high 5 service aces, followed by Kubra Tanrikulu, with 3 aces. Haeckel's 7 block assists led the Highlanders at the net.

NJIT faced Providence later Saturday afternoon to close out play in the tournament.
